Patricia Catherine (nee Philpot) DeBord, age 83 of Hamilton, passed away on Saturday, January 30, 2021 at Fort Hamilton Hospital. She was born on July 22, 1937 in Urban, KY, the daughter of the late Bradley and Mary (Bishop) Philpot. Patricia attended Eastern Kentucky University and earned both her Bachelor’s and Master’s in Education from Miami University. She took pride in her teaching, gardening, and farming. Patricia is survived by her children, Jeffrey (Amy) Darner and Valerie (Tim) Guthrie; step-children, Brenda (Mike) Windsor, Victoria Dean, Cynthia (Greg) Barker, Anna Darner, and Steve (Lori) DeBord; step-daughter-in-law, Cathy Darner; numerous grandchildren and great-grandchildren; and siblings, Brenda (Harold) Risner, Janet Philpot, Carl (Patsy) Philpot, Marvin (Uncha) Philpot, James Philpot, and Donald (Dottie) Philpot. She was preceded in death by her parents; husbands, Ronald Gene DeBord and Russell Winston Darner; step-children, Bruce Darner and Elaine Darner; and brother, Gordon Philpot.
